Geometrical OpticsHard
Question
A telescope consisting of objective of focal length 60 cm and a single lens eye piece of focal length 5cm is focussed at a distant object in such a way that parallel rays emerge from the eye piece. If the object subtends an angle of 2o at the objective, then angular width of image will be.
Options
A.10o
B.24o
C.50o
D.1/6o
